Skyrim IS Elder Scrolls V. If you want to know if you need to play the earlier games first, the answer is no , as they are self-contained, separate stories, though set in the same universe. Skyrim does cut down on manyof the tabletop-like mechanics from previous Elder Scrolls games, such as certain skills and the character creation system. The Elder Scrolls are ancient prophecies of unknown origin which, when read by the trained eye, show the reader just one possible version of events from the past or future. Unless you have nostalgia from playing it before, it does not hold up well. (That may be personal, as Cyrodiil looks alot like Britain, my home). 2023 GAMESPOT, A FANDOM COMPANY. The Elder Scrolls games share a universe, but not a connected timeline.
